If you find yourself in the unfortunate situation of losing your car key, one of the first steps you should take is to contact your car manufacturer. They are usually the best source for getting a new key that is specifically designed for your vehicle.

Here are a few reasons why reaching out to your car manufacturer can be beneficial:

  1. Expertise: Car manufacturers have intricate knowledge about their vehicles and their security systems. By contacting them, you can ensure that you’re getting a key that will work seamlessly with your car’s ignition and door locks.
  2. Authenticity: When it comes to something as important as a car key, authenticity matters. Going directly to the manufacturer guarantees that you’ll receive a genuine replacement key rather than relying on third-party vendors who may not provide the same level of quality or security.
  3. Compatibility: Each car model has its own unique specifications, including the type of key required. By contacting your car manufacturer, they can help determine whether you need a traditional metal key, a transponder key, or even a smart key with remote access capabilities.
  4. Warranty Considerations: If your vehicle is still under warranty, obtaining a replacement key from the car manufacturer ensures that any warranty coverage remains intact. It’s always wise to consult with them before seeking alternative options.

When contacting your car manufacturer, be prepared with essential information such as your vehicle identification number (VIN) and proof of ownership. This will help expedite the process and ensure accuracy in providing you with an appropriate replacement key.

Remember, while reaching out to your car manufacturer may involve some waiting time and potentially higher costs compared to other options, it offers peace of mind knowing that you’re taking the necessary steps to obtain an authentic and compatible replacement for your lost car key.

Get in Touch with a Car Dealership

When faced with the predicament of losing your car key, one effective solution is to reach out to a car dealership. These establishments are well-equipped to assist you in obtaining a new key for your vehicle. Here’s how you can go about it:

  1. Contact the nearest dealership: Begin by finding the closest car dealership that sells and services your specific car brand. A quick online search or a look through your vehicle’s documentation should provide you with the necessary information. Once you have identified the dealership, give them a call to explain your situation.
  2. Provide necessary details: When speaking with the dealership representative, be prepared to provide essential details about your vehicle, such as its make, model, year of manufacture, and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). This information will help ensure that they can accurately assist you in replacing your lost key.
  3. Schedule an appointment: In most cases, arranging an appointment with the dealership will be necessary. This allows them time to prepare for your visit and ensures that they have the required equipment and personnel available to address your needs promptly.
  4. Bring identification and proof of ownership: On the day of your appointment, remember to bring along valid identification documents as well as proof of ownership for the vehicle. This may include documents like registration papers or insurance certificates. These items are typically required by dealerships as part of their security measures before providing a replacement key.
  5. Consider additional costs: While each dealership operates differently when it comes to pricing policies, it’s important to be aware that obtaining a new car key may come at an additional cost beyond just labor charges. Inquire about any potential fees involved during your initial conversation so that there are no surprises later on.

By following these steps and reaching out to a reputable car dealership, you’ll be able to initiate the process of getting a new key for your lost one quickly and efficiently. Remember to remain patient throughout the process, as it may take some time for the dealership to procure or program a replacement key specific to your vehicle.

If you find yourself in the unfortunate situation of losing your car keys, one important step to take is filing a police report. While not always required, filing a report with the local authorities can be beneficial for several reasons:

  1. Documentation: By reporting the loss of your car keys to the police, you create an official record of the incident. This documentation can come in handy when dealing with insurance claims or any other legal matters that may arise as a result of the lost keys.
  2. Theft Prevention: If you suspect that your keys were stolen rather than simply misplaced, filing a police report can help prevent potential theft or unauthorized use of your vehicle. The authorities will be aware of the situation and can take necessary actions to ensure your safety and protect your vehicle from being used unlawfully.
  3. Insurance Purposes: Some insurance companies require a police report for key replacement coverage or reimbursement for any damages resulting from the lost keys. It’s essential to check with your insurance provider about their specific requirements and policies regarding lost car keys.
  4. Recovery Assistance: In certain cases, law enforcement agencies may be able to assist in recovering lost car keys by providing guidance or connecting you with relevant resources such as locksmiths or automotive services that specialize in key replacements.

When filing a police report for lost car keys, it’s important to provide accurate details about when and where the incident occurred, any suspicious circumstances surrounding the loss, and any additional information that might aid in locating or replacing your missing keys.

Remember to keep copies of all relevant documents related to the police report as well as any receipts or invoices for key replacement services. These will serve as valuable evidence should you need them later on.
